About Us
American Century Investments® is a leading global asset manager with over 65 years of experience helping a broad base of clients achieve their financial goals. Our expertise spans global equities and fixed income, multi-asset strategies, ETFs, and private investments.
Privately controlled and independent, we focus solely on investment management. But there’s an unexpected side to us, too. We direct over 40% of our profits every year—more than $2 billion since 2000—to the Stowers Institute for Medical Research. Our ongoing financial support drives the Institute’s breakthrough work and mission of defeating life-threatening diseases like cancer and Alzheimer’s. So, the better we do for our clients, the more we can do for everyone.

Role Summary
The Financial Consultant is responsible for the business development of a defined book of business of American Century’s high net worth client base with greater than $250k in investable assets, and accountable for acquiring new assets and new clients to American Century Investments. This sales position is responsible for self-generating new opportunities within an assigned territory/book by establishing trust and rapport with American Century Investments’ clients and prospects to build long-term relationships. You will serve between 300-400 clients when the book reaches full capacity.
This hybrid position will be based out of our Kansas City office.
